Vehicle accident with injuries on I-76 Westbound, Portage County OH
A vehicle collision with injuries happened on I-76 Westbound near mile marker 32. Emergency responders including fire and EMS were dispatched. The left lane was closed. A second person involved did not stop at the scene.
